Bactrocera frauenfeldi (Schiner), the ‘mango fruit fly’, is a horticultural pest originating from the Papua New Guinea region. It was first detected in Australia on Cape York Peninsula in north Queensland in 1974 and had spread to Cairns by 1994 and Townsville by 1997. Bactrocera frauenfeldi has not been recorded further south since then despite its invasive potential, an absence of any controls and an abundance of hosts in southern areas. Analysis of cue-lure trapping data from 1997 to 2012 in relation to environmental variables shows that the distribution of B. frauenfeldi in Queensland correlates to locations with a minimum temperature for the coldest month >13.2°C, annual temperature range <19.3°C, mean temperature of the driest quarter >20.2°C, precipitation of the wettest month >268 mm, precipitation of the wettest quarter >697 mm, temperature seasonality <30.9°C (i.e. lower temperature variability) and areas with higher human population per square kilometre. Annual temperature range was the most important variable in predicting this species' distribution. Predictive distribution maps based on an uncorrelated subset of these variables reasonably reflected the current distribution of this species in northern Australia and predicted other areas in the world potentially at risk from invasion by this species. This analysis shows that the distribution of B. frauenfeldi in Australia is correlated to certain environmental variables that have most likely limited this species' spread southward in Queensland. This is of importance to Australian horticulture in demonstrating that B. frauenfeldi is unlikely to establish in horticultural production areas further south than Townsville.

El estudio fue realizado en la Reserva Natural Isla Juan Venado, León, con el fin de evaluar potencialidades para desarrollar el ecoturismo en la zona, con base en los atractivos escénicos, socioculturales y científicos, infraestructura y servicios que pueden ofertar las comunidades de la zona de amortiguamiento. El proceso metodológico se desarrolló en cuatro etapas: (1) se visitó el sitio, se contactaron líderes comunales, representantes del MARENA y se recopiló información secundaria; (2) se realizó un Diagnóstico Rural Participativo (evaluación del grado de conocimiento de los pobladores sobre la Reserva, elaboración de mapa de sitios de interés ecoturistico, desarrollo de matriz de priorización de problemas y del análisis FODA), la visita y georeferenciación de sitios determinados anteriormente y aplicación de encuestas a pobladores y visitantes para conocer percepción sobre los potenciales de la Reserva y las capacidades locales para el desarrollo ecoturistico; (3) se procesó y analizó la información obtenida, se diseñó un mapa de ubicación georeferenciada de los sitios de interés y se analizaron las encuestas; y (4) se elaboraron dos propuestas de paquetes ecoturísticos para la Reserva y se presentaron a través de un taller a las comunidades. Como resultados tenemos: ocho sitios de interés: Estero Juan Venado, El Corcovado, Las Navajas, La Flor, El Mango, El Icaco, Casa Las Peñas y Viveros de Tortugas, resaltando la gran diversidad de flora y fauna que poseen, anidamientos de diferentes especies de fauna, ecosistemas representativos de manglares y humedales, transición de manglares a bosques secos y sitios de protección y conservación de huevos de la tortuga paslama. Se pudo determinar, que aunque no haya las condiciones óptimas de servicios e infraestructura, podrían mejorarse y los recursos de la Reserva pueden ser utilizados en beneficio de las comunidades, considerando que sus miembros presentan disposición para desarrollar el ecoturismo en la zona. Las dos propuestas de paquetes ecoturísticos presentadas, fueron aceptadas y mejoradas por los beneficiarios.

El peligro aviario es el riesgo de coliciones entre aves y aeronaves. Para reducir ese peligro es necesario entender la naturaleza de las aves que habitan dentro y alrededor del aeropuerto y clasificarlas numericamente en base a la peligrosidad que representan, conociendo a la vez las estaciones del año, los meses del año, horas del día, condiciones climáticas, focos de atracción (cobertura, alimentación y agua) que incrementan la abundancia y la riqueza de aves en las áreas aeroportuarias. Para obtener la información se seleccionaron dos sitios de observación: uno en las áreas verdes alrededor de la pista de aterrizaje, con el objetivo de registrar las especies de aves hacen uso de este sitio permanente o temporalmente, y otro en la torre de control, para determinar rutas de aves de mayor peso, gregarias y de alto vuelo en un radio de 3000 m con centro en la torre de control. Las especies observadas con mayor frecuencia en la pista de aterrizaje fueron: Hirundo rustica, Quiscalus mexicanus, Molothrus aeneus, Columbina talpacoti y Columba livia. Desde la torre de control se observaron con mayor frecuencia: Coragyps atratus, Zenaida asiatica, Molotrus aeneus y Quiscalus mexicanus. En la pista de aterrizaje y desde la torre de control la abundancia y riqueza de aves no varió significativamente a lo largo dlos meses del año. En la pista de aterrizaje la abundancia incrementa significativamente en el período seco en horarios de 06:00-07:00 am, principalmente por la presencia de Q. mexicanus y H. rustica. La riqueza en el periodo seco y la abundancia y riqueza en el período lluvioso no varió significativamente. Desde la torre de control no se registraron incrementos significativos de la abundancia y riqueza de aves en el período seco, pero si de la abundancia en el período lluvioso, con alzas a las 11:00 y 13:00, principalmente por la mayores actividades de la especie C. atratus a esas horas. La abundancia de aves en la pista de aterrizaje dependió de las condiciones climáticas, aumentando al aumentar la precipitación y la nubosidad y reduciéndose al aumentar la velocidad del viento y la temperatura. La actividad de las aves observadas desde la torre de control no varió significativamente con las variaciones climáticas diarias. Las especies que hacen mayor uso del enmallado perimetral del aeropuerto para perchar fueron: Passers domesticus, Columbina talpacoti, Tyrannus melancholicus, Crotophaga sulcirostris y Tyrannus forficatus. Los sitios preferidos para anidación dentro del aeropuerto fueron árboles de Almendra ( Terminalia catapa ), Mango ( Manguifera indica ) y dentro del las instalacones del cuerpo de Bomberos, torre de control y los hangares. Se concluye que C. atratus y Q. mexicanus son las especies que más peligro representan para la aviación, seguidas en menor escala de C. livia , C. talpocati, H. rustica y M. aeneus. Los sectores norte, oeste y una parte del sector sur del aeropuerto son áreas de mayor riesgo aviario por una mayor frecuencia de observación de C. atratus en esa zona. La especie Q. mexicanus esta distribuida principalmente en el sector sureste. Las fuentes de atracción para las aves van desde sitios ideales para hábitat, refugio, anidación y perchaje hasta fuente de alimentos que incluyen vegetales, insectos, vertebrados, basureros y mataderos.

Nesta pesquisa o objetivo principal é discutir o padrão de beleza historicamente hegemónicos em uma escola Pública Muncipal de Educação Infantil, na periferia do Rio de Janeiro, em Acari. Tenho como pressuposto para pesquisa que neste tempoespaço escolar se estabelece uma tensão entre as invisibilidades e visibilidades de imagens de heróis e heroínas e suas narrativas africanas e afrobrasileiras em relação às identidades, pois nesse espaço escolar parte da representação do humano é preferencialmente eurocêntrico-branca, embora os indivíduos que frequentam àquele espaço - crianças e educadoras sejam em sua grande maioria negros e mestiços. É neste cotidiano escolar que desenvolvo uma pesquisa/intervenção, articulando brincadeiras e tecnologias com literatura infantil da contemporaneidade. Intervenção que propõe uma discussão em torno da ética e da estética. Tal abordagem me instiga a investigar e a discutir as questões de relação étnico-raciais dessa escola e as emergências de heróis e heroínas da afrodiáspora.

衰老和冷害是果实采后极易发生的两种重要的生理性失调,严重影响了果实的商品质量和市场价值。本论文选用在采后贮藏期间容易衰老和出现冷害的枇杷、杧果和桃果实作为研究材料,比较深入系统地研究了这些果实采后衰老或冷害的机理和调控。主要的研究内容包括:(1)枇杷果实在不同贮藏条件下(低温、气调)的生理代谢、品质变化、衰老进程和贮藏性;(2)杧果果实采后生理特性及外源草酸和水杨酸处理对杧果冷害、品质和活性氧代谢的影响;(3)桃果实在低温贮藏下冷害发生特征,并从氧化还原平衡和蛋白质组表达方面探讨了桃果实采后冷害的发生机理。 试验结果表明:(1)与自发气调包装(MAP)相比,气调(CA, 10% O2+1%CO2)能更有效的抑制枇杷果实的腐烂、延缓衰老、保持品质,以及控制多聚半乳糖醛酸酶(PG)和多酚氧化酶(PPO)的活性。枇杷果实在1 ºC气调下贮藏50天,腐烂指数低于7%,并保持固有的风味品质。短时间的高氧处理对果实腐烂和品质影响不大,促进了贮藏后期果实内乙醇的积累;(2)外源草酸和水杨酸处理显著减轻了杧果果实在贮藏期间的冷害程度,但对果实的硬度、可溶性固型物和可滴定酸含量影响不大。外源草酸和水杨酸提高了果实内抗坏血酸和谷胱甘肽的还原状态、提高了H2O2含量、降低了O2-含量和脂氧合酶活性,并提高了超氧化物岐化酶、过氧化氢酶、过氧化物酶、抗坏血酸氧化酶和谷胱甘肽还原酶的活性;(3)与非冷害桃果实相比,冷害桃果实呈现较低的H2O2含量、较高的膜透性、较高的酚类物质含量以及较高的抗坏血酸和谷胱甘肽还原状态。水杨酸对果实内H2O2含量、膜透性、酚类物质含量有显著的影响。冷害桃果实与非冷害桃果实的蛋白质表达也有明显的区别,32个差异表达蛋白依其功能分为8类,分别为能量产生、代谢、次生代谢、抗性、蛋白质的分布、基因转录、细胞结构和细胞生长。水杨酸对其中20个蛋白质的表达有显著影响。烯醇化酶、脂质运载蛋白、脱水蛋白、分支酸变位酶以及桂醇脱氢酶等与桃冷害发生有密切关系。 通过对上述结果的分析,得出如下结论:(1)与MAP相比,CA(10% O2 + 1% CO2)可显著延缓枇杷果实的衰老、腐烂和品质下降,CA延缓枇杷衰老的作用机理可能与其减轻果实内氧胁迫、降低PG和PPO活性有关;(2)用外源草酸或水杨酸处理杧果,可减轻贮藏期间果实的冷害程度,其调控机制可能与提高果实抗坏血酸和谷胱甘肽的还原状态、抑制O2-含量和提高H2O2含量有关;(3)在低温贮藏下,桃冷害发生与果实内较低的H2O2含量、生物膜完整性的破坏以及酚类物质含量增加密切相关,果实生物膜完整性的破坏与烯醇化酶、脂质运载蛋白、过敏蛋白以及脱水蛋白的下调表达有关,而酚类物质含量的增加与分支酸变位酶、桂醇脱氢酶的上调表达有关。

A detailed study on arsenical creosote with reference to leaching, corrosion and anti-borer properties was carried out. Results showed that aging had very little effect on the preservative which suggested better fixation of the preservative into the wood. Corrosion of mild steel, galvanised iron, aluminium-magnesium alloy (M57S) and copper panels in the preservative was found to be negligible. Normal creosote and low temperature creosote of Regional Research Laboratory, Hyderabad, both fortified with arsenic trioxide resisted borer damage on wooden panels for a period of over five months in the port of Cochin. The performance of low temperature creosote fortified with arsenic was found to be equally satisfactory when compared to normal creosote fortified in the same manner. A loading of 208.6 Kgs/ml³ for Haldu (Adina cordifolia) and 138 Kgs/m³ for Mango (Mangifera indica) in the case of normal creosote and 177 Kgs/m³ for Mango the case of RRL creosote were found to be sufficient for treating the wood.

"Había un árbol enorme que estaba repleto de toda clase de alimentos sabrosos, del que solo disfrutaban unos pocos que vivían en la copa. Abajo, sabían de la existencia de esa riqueza, pues caían, de vez en cuando, trozos de mango, papaya. Los animales de abajo se organizaron para cortar el árbol, pero, al llegar la noche, éste soltaba una resina y se curaba; un día trabajaron día y noche y terminaron de talar el árbol, no obstante éste quedó enganchado en la copa con una liana y poco a poco empezaba a brotar la resina y se volvía a pegar, Llamaron a una ardillita para que se trepara y desliara la copa; como era tan pequeña, arriba no la vieron. Deslió la copa y el árbol calló y rajándose por la mitad brotó como un manantial de comida que se repartió entre todos, según sus necesidades." Este mito, que de alguna manera es común a muchos pueblos indios de la región caribe amazónica, sirve para introducir eltema que tratamos en Cumbayá, Ecuador, entre los días 29 de Octubre y el6 de Noviembrede 1995.

The goal of this thesis is to look at the critical and dissenting value of exhibitions through the examination of four cases studies, based on six exhibitions taking place between 1968 and 1998 in Latin and North America. The exhibitions belong to the history of modern and contemporary exhibitions and curating, a field of research and study that has only started to be written about in the last two decades. This investigation contributes to it, in its creation of new genealogies by connecting previously overlooked antecedents, or by proposing new relations within established lineages, at the intersection of a specific historiography; to address exhibitions, a tradition of artists acting as curators and an emerging history of curating. The examined exhibitions were put together by artists or artist collectives and were placed in a liminal position between artistic and curatorial practice. All the cases presented a distinct proposal in relation to art and social change, a fact that connects them, in their aims and modus operandi, to a Marxist and neo-Marxist critical and transformative legacy. The cases address the following connections: exhibition as political site (Tucumán Arde, 1968); exhibition as social space (The People’s Choice (Arroz con Mango), 1981); exhibition as encounter (Rooms with a view, We the People, Art/Artifact, 1987-88); and exhibition as an exchange situation (El Museo de la Calle, 1998-2001). Key to their analysis is the concept of dissensus, as put forward by Jacques Rancière. Within this theoretical framework, these exhibitions put into practice particular cases of dissensus in a given distribution of the sensible. All of them tried to deal with their thematic concerns by performing them as a praxis. They dissent with the way in which reality was formatted in their historical moment and challenge the exhibition medium itself opening new ways of doing and making in the exhibition field. Therefore, in this thesis the dissenting value of exhibitions is closely related to its main features as a medium, namely their temporality, heterogeneity and flexibility, which contribute to their potential for creative analysis and propositioning. In the case of these exhibitions, this capability is brought into play for institutional interrogation, for offering alternative cultural narratives and also for inspiring new imaginary realms.

La migration internationale d’étudiants est un investissement couteux pour les familles dans beaucoup de pays en voie de développement. Cependant, cet investissement est susceptible de générer des bénéfices financiers et sociaux relativement importants aux investisseurs, tout autant que des externalités pour d’autres membres de la famille. Cette thèse s’intéresse à deux aspects importants de la migration des étudiants internationaux : (i) Qui part? Quels sont les déterminants de la probabilité de migration? (ii) Qui paie? Comment la famille s’organise-t-elle pour couvrir les frais de la migration? (iii) Qui y gagne? Ce flux migratoire est-il au bénéfice du pays d’origine? Entreprendre une telle étude met le chercheur en face de défis importants, notamment, l’absence de données complètes et fiables; la dispersion géographique des étudiants migrants en étant la cause première. La première contribution importante de ce travail est le développement d’une méthode de sondage en « boule de neige » pour des populations difficiles à atteindre, ainsi que d’estimateurs corrigeant les possibles biais de sélection. A partir de cette méthodologie, j’ai collecté des données incluant simultanément des étudiants migrants et non-migrants du Cameroun en utilisant une plateforme internet. Un second défi relativement bien documenté est la présence d’endogénéité du choix d’éducation. Nous tirons avantage des récents développements théoriques dans le traitement des problèmes d’identification dans les modèles de choix discrets pour résoudre cette difficulté, tout en conservant la simplicité des hypothèses nécessaires. Ce travail constitue l’une des premières applications de cette méthodologie à des questions de développement. Le premier chapitre de la thèse étudie la décision prise par la famille d’investir dans la migration étudiante. Il propose un modèle structurel empirique de choix discret qui reflète à la fois le rendement brut de la migration et la contrainte budgétaire liée au problème de choix des agents. Nos résultats démontrent que le choix du niveau final d’éducation, les résultats académiques et l’aide de la famille sont des déterminants importants de la probabilité d’émigrer, au contraire du genre qui ne semble pas affecter très significativement la décision familiale. Le second chapitre s’efforce de comprendre comment les agents décident de leur participation à la décision de migration et comment la famille partage les profits et décourage le phénomène de « passagers clandestins ». D’autres résultats dans la littérature sur l’identification partielle nous permettent de considérer des comportements stratégiques au sein de l’unité familiale. Les premières estimations suggèrent que le modèle « unitaire », où un agent représentatif maximise l’utilité familiale ne convient qu’aux familles composées des parents et de l’enfant. Les aidants extérieurs subissent un cout strictement positif pour leur participation, ce qui décourage leur implication. Les obligations familiales et sociales semblent expliquer les cas de participation d’un aidant, mieux qu’un possible altruisme de ces derniers. Finalement, le troisième chapitre présente le cadre théorique plus général dans lequel s’imbriquent les modèles développés dans les précédents chapitres. Les méthodes d’identification et d’inférence présentées sont spécialisées aux jeux finis avec information complète. Avec mes co-auteurs, nous proposons notamment une procédure combinatoire pour une implémentation efficace du bootstrap aux fins d’inférences dans les modèles cités ci-dessus. Nous en faisons une application sur les déterminants du choix familial de soins à long terme pour des parents âgés.

Heavy metals are major toxic pollutants with severe health effects on humans. They are released into the environment from a variety of industrial activities. Cadmium, lead, zinc, chromium and copper are the most toxic metals of widespread use in industries such as tanning, electroplating, electronic equipment manufacturing and chemical processing plants. Heavy metals contribute to a variety of adverse health environmental effects due to their acute and chronic exposure through air, water and food chain. Conventional treatment methods of metal removal are often limited by their cost and ineffectiveness at low concentrations. Adsorption, the use of inactivated biomass as adsorbents offers an attractive potential alternative to their conventional methods. Mango peel and Alisma plantago aquatica are naturally occurring and abundant biomass can offer an economical solution for metal removal.The Cd(II), Pb(II), Zn(II), Cr(III) and Cu(II) adsorption by milled adsorbents of mango peel and Alisma plantago aquatica were evaluated in batches.

Parasitic weeds of the genera Striga, Orobanche, and Phelipanche pose a severe problem for agriculture because they are difficult to control and are highly destructive to several crops. The present work was carried out during the period October, 2009 to February, 2012 to evaluate the potential of arbuscular mycorrhizal fungi (AMF) to suppress P. ramosa on tomatoes and to investigate the effects of air-dried powder and aqueous extracts from Euphorbia hirta on germination and haustorium initiation in Phelipanche ramosa. The work was divided into three parts: a survey of the indigenous mycorrhizal flora in Sudan, second, laboratory and greenhouse experiments (conducted in Germany and Sudan) to construct a base for the third part, which was a field trial in Sudan. A survey was performed in 2009 in the White Nile state, Sudan to assess AMF spore densities and root colonization in nine fields planted with 13 different important agricultural crops. In addition, an attempt was made to study the relationship between soil physico-chemical properties and AMF spore density, colonization rate, species richness and other diversity indices. The mean percentage of AMF colonization was 34%, ranging from 19-50%. The spore densities (expressed as per 100 g dry soil) retrieved from the rhizosphere of different crops were relatively high, varying from 344 to 1222 with a mean of 798. There was no correlation between spore densities in soil and root colonization percentage. A total of 45 morphologically classifiable species representing ten genera of AMF were detected with no correlation between the number of species found in a soil sample and the spore density. The most abundant genus was Glomus (20 species). The AMF diversity expressed by the Shannon–Weaver index was highest in sorghum (H\= 2.27) and Jews mallow (H\= 2.13) and lowest in alfalfa (H\= 1.4). With respect to crop species, the genera Glomus and Entrophospora were encountered in almost all crops, except for Entrophospora in alfalfa. Kuklospora was found only in sugarcane and sorghum. The genus Ambispora was recovered only in mint and okra, while mint and onion were the only species on which no Acaulospora was found. The hierarchical cluster analysis based on the similarity among AMF communities with respect to crop species overall showed that species compositions were relatively similar with the highest dissimilarity of about 25% separating three of the mango samples and the four sorghum samples from all other samples. Laboratory experiments studied the influence of root and stem exudates of three tomato varieties infected by three different Glomus species on germination of P. ramosa. Root exudates were collected 21or 42 days after transplanting (DAT) and stem exudates 42 DAT and tested for their effects on germination of P. ramosa seeds in vitro. The tomato varieties studied did not have an effect on either mycorrhizal colonization or Phelipanche germination. Germination in response to exudates from 42 day old mycorrhizal plants was significantly reduced in comparison to non-mycorrhizal controls. Germination of P. ramosa in response to root exudates from 21 day old plants was consistently higher than for 42 day-old plants (F=121.6; P<.0001). Stem diffusates from non-mycorrhizal plants invariably elicited higher germination than diffusates from the corresponding mycorrhizal ones and differences were mostly statistically significant. A series of laboratory experiments was undertaken to investigate the effects of aqueous extracts from Euphorbia hirta on germination, radicle elongation, and haustorium initiation in P. ramosa. P. ramosa seeds conditioned in water and subsequently treated with diluted E. hirta extract (10-25% v/v) displayed considerable germination (47-62%). Increasing extract concentration to 50% or more reduced germination in response to the synthetic germination stimulants GR24 and Nijmegen-1 in a concentration dependent manner. P. ramosa germlings treated with diluted Euphorbia extract (10-75 % v/v) displayed haustorium initiation comparable to 2, 5-Dimethoxy-p-benzoquinon (DMBQ) at 20 µM. Euphorbia extract applied during conditioning reduced haustorium initiation in a concentration dependent manner. E. hirta extract or air-dried powder, applied to soil, induced considerable P. ramosa germination. Pot experiments were undertaken in a glasshouse at the University of Kassel, Germany, to investigate the effects of P. ramosa seed bank on tomato growth parameters. Different Phelipanche seed banks were established by mixing the parasite seeds (0 - 32 mg) with the potting medium in each pot. P. ramosa reduced all tomato growth parameters measured and the reduction progressively increased with seed bank. Root and total dry matter accumulation per tomato plant were most affected. P. ramosa emergence, number of tubercles, and tubercle dry weight increased with the seed bank and were, invariably, maximal with the highest seed bank. Another objective was to determine if different AM fungi differ in their effects on the colonization of tomatoes with P. ramosa and the performance of P. ramosa after colonization. Three AMF species viz. GIomus intraradices, Glomus mosseae and Glomus Sprint® were used in this study. For the infection, P. ramosa seeds (8 mg) were mixed with the top 5 cm soil in each pot. No mycorrhizal colonization was detected in un-inoculated control plants. P. ramosa infested, mycorrhiza inoculated tomato plants had significantly lower AMF colonization compared to plants not infested with P. ramosa. Inoculation with G. intraradices, G. mosseae and Glomus Sprint® reduced the number of emerged P. ramosa plants by 29.3, 45.3 and 62.7% and the number of tubercles by 22.2, 42 and 56.8%, respectively. Mycorrhizal root colonization was positively correlated with number of branches and total dry matter of tomatoes. Field experiments on tomato undertaken in 2010/12 were only partially successful because of insect infestations which resulted in the complete destruction of the second run of the experiment. The effects of the inoculation with AMF, the addition of 10 t ha-1 filter mud (FM), an organic residues from sugar processing and 36 or 72 kg N ha-1 on the infestation of tomatoes with P. ramosa were assessed. In un-inoculated control plants, AMF colonization ranged between 13.4 to 22.1% with no significant differences among FM and N treatments. Adding AMF or FM resulted in a significant increase of branching in the tomato plants with no additive effects. Dry weights were slightly increased through FM application when no N was applied and significantly at 36 kg N ha-1. There was no effect of FM on the time until the first Phelipanche emerged while AMF and N application interacted. Especially AMF inoculation resulted in a tendency to delayed P. ramosa emergence. The marketable yield was extremely low due to the strong fruit infestation with insects mainly whitefly Bemisia tabaci and tomato leaf miner (Tuta absoluta). Tomatoes inoculated with varied mycorrhiza species displayed different response to the insect infestation, as G. intraradices significantly reduced the infestation, while G. mosseae elicited higher insect infestation. The results of the present thesis indicate that there may be a potential of developing management strategies for P. ramosa targeting the pre-attachment stage namely germination and haustorial initiation using plant extracts. However, ways of practical use need to be developed. If such treatments can be combined with AMF inoculation also needs to be investigated. Overall, it will require a systematic approach to develop management tools that are easily applicable and affordable to Sudanese farmers. It is well-known that proper agronomical practices such as the design of an optimum crop rotation in cropping systems, reduced tillage, promotion of cover crops, the introduction of multi-microbial inoculants, and maintenance of proper phosphorus levels are advantageous if the mycorrhiza protection method is exploited against Phelipanche ramosa infestation. Without the knowledge about the biology of the parasitic weeds by the farmers and basic preventive measures such as hygiene and seed quality control no control strategy will be successful, however.
